Thorsten Bruchhäuser has extensive work experience in various positions in the sales and business development field. Thorsten is currently serving as the Chief Revenue Officer (CRO) at Papershift since November 2022. Prior to this, they worked as the Chief Revenue Officer at gridscale GmbH from March 2021 to November 2022, and also held the role of Head of Sales from February 2020 to February 2021.
Before joining gridscale GmbH, Thorsten Bruchhäuser worked as the VP Sales & Marketing at nyris GmbH from July 2019 to January 2020. Prior to that, they served as the Vice President Sales & Business Development at solute gmbh from November 2015 to June 2019.
Earlier in their career, Thorsten Bruchhäuser held senior positions at Avira GmbH, McAfee Security, F-Secure Corporation, and Infoconcept GmbH. At Avira GmbH, they served as the VP Sales and Business Development from April 2012 to October 2015, and also held the position of Director of Consumer Business Global from September 2010 to April 2012. At McAfee Security, they worked as the Senior Consumer Partner Manager - D-A-CH from May 2008 to September 2010, and previously held the role of Consumer Partner Manager from July 2005 to May 2008. Thorsten started their career at F-Secure Corporation as an Account Manager from October 1999 to June 2005, and prior to that, they were an IT Security Teamleader at Infoconcept GmbH from April 1996 to September 1999.

Papershift is a SaaS solution for planning, tracking and reporting of working time in companies. Founded in 2015 and based in Karlsruhe, Germany, the company currently employs about 50 people and has several thousand customers in over ten European countries. The team’s vision is to help organizations better organize themselves. For example, teamscan use Papershift to create duty or vacation schedules, as well as record and evaluate times. In each case, this can be done via mobile apps, a browser, terminals or via the API. The possibilities of Papershift’s software are also enhanced considerably by an open API, integrations with third-party systems, and a dedicated app store with add-ons.
